Odisha CM Inaugurates 5th Edition Of Eco Retreat At 4 Exotic Locations

Bhubaneswar: The 5th edition of Eco Retreat 2023-24 was inaugurated by Chief Minister Naveen Patnaik on Wednesday. The much-awaited glamping event of Odisha is now open for tourists at four exotic locations – Putsil in Koraput, Daringbadi, Satkosia and Hirakud.

Inaugurating the event virtually, the Chief Minister said that after four successful editions, Odisha government’s flagship product eco retreat has been highly appreciated by the travel and tourism fraternity for its sustainable model incorporating best practices in waste to wealth and holistic resource management while offering tourists a more refined leisure hospitality akin to star category resorts.

MLAs, district Collectors, SPs, CDOs, OTDC Chairman Lenin Mohanty, and officials of Department of Tourism were present on the occasion.

After the success of the first edition in 2019 at Ramchandi Beach (Konark), in 2020 the event was introduced in four new destinations in Baliput (Satkosia), Bhitarkanika, Daringbadi and Hirakud apart from Konark. In 2022, two more additions in Putsil (Koraput) and Sonapur Beach were introduced.

This year it is back in a much bigger way with exciting watersports, and other recreational activities. Eco Retreat Bhitarkanika and Sonapur beach will be inaugurated on December 1 and Eco Retreat Konark on December 15, an official release said.

Notably, the Eco Retreats in Odisha are committed for being a zero-waste discharge tourism initiative, ensuring that the environment remains unharmed. These retreats are strategically positioned in ecologically sensitive areas, and Odisha Tourism has taken measures to ensure that the tourism activities in these destinations have a minimal impact on the natural environment.

These retreats adhere strictly to the guidelines and standard operating procedures established by the Union Ministry of Health and Family Welfare. All the Eco Retreats at these 4 destinations have 25 tents each and is equipped with exciting activities.

1-Hirakud – Nestled between Debrigarh Wildlife Sanctuary and the reservoir, the glamping site of Eco Retreat Hirakud offers an opportunity to explore the vibrant culture of Western Odisha and delectable traditional Odia cuisine. Expect guided treks into the Debrigarh Wildlife Sanctuary or find your wild side from a range of exciting water sports activities like parasailing, jet skiing, banana boat rides, etc.

2-Daringbadi – Popularly known by the locals as the Kashmir of Odisha, Daringbadi hill station surrounded by beautiful valleys and plateaus that are dotted with coffee and pepper gardens, this campsite is incredibly scenic. Perfect for those looking to luxuriate in tranquil environs, this eco retreat’s itinerary includes visits to Midubandha waterfall, and Daringbadi coffee garden. Other recreational activities on offer include rifle shooting, archery, bicycling, and yoga on the hills, etc.

3- Satkosia – Satkosia spreads along the magnificent gorge over the mighty Mahanadi River. Beauty of this gorge is that this is the meeting point of two bio-geographic regions of India – the Deccan Peninsula and the Eastern Ghats. This biodiversity rich hotspot houses the Satkosia Tiger Reserve and this glamping retreat rests camouflaged on the banks of the Mahanadi River next to the tiger sanctuary, a perfect destination for anyone who wants to experience luxury in the lap of nature. Other activities at the camp include volleyball, archery, rifle shooting, cultural performances, etc.

4- Putsil – Perched on the Deomali hill range of the eastern ghats, Eco Retreat Putsil is a region unharmed by the nuances of commercialism and pollution. Many tourists come here for winter picnics in the mountains. When the clouds touch the mountains of the valley, it enchants tourists. On the way to Putsil Valley, you can enjoy waterfalls, springs, and a coffee garden.

Tourists visiting these destinations this winter can experience 5-star facilities through glamorous camps amidst the lap of nature. Various activities like guided tours, adventure activities like water sport, paragliding are included to make their stay memorable
